What is the Use of Fractions in Time?

Definition
What is it?

Fractions help us understand and describe parts of an hour, a minute, or a day. Just like you can have half a roti, you can have half an hour, which is 30 minutes. They make it easy to talk about periods shorter than a full unit of time.

Simple Example
Quick Example

Imagine your favourite TV show starts in 'quarter of an hour'. This means it starts in 1/4 of an hour. Since 1 hour has 60 minutes, 1/4 of an hour is 15 minutes. So, you know the show starts in 15 minutes!

Worked Example
Step-by-Step

PROBLEM: Your school recess is 1/3 of an hour long. How many minutes is that?

STEP 1: Understand what 1/3 of an hour means. It means dividing 1 hour into 3 equal parts.
---STEP 2: We know that 1 hour = 60 minutes.
---STEP 3: To find 1/3 of 60 minutes, we divide 60 by 3.
---STEP 4: 60 divided by 3 is 20.
---STEP 5: So, 1/3 of an hour is 20 minutes.

ANSWER: Your school recess is 20 minutes long.

Common Mistakes

MISTAKE: Thinking 1/2 hour is 50 minutes because 1/2 of 100 is 50. | CORRECTION: Remember that 1 hour has 60 minutes, not 100 minutes. So, 1/2 of 60 minutes is 30 minutes.

MISTAKE: Confusing 'quarter past' with 'quarter to'. | CORRECTION: 'Quarter past' means 15 minutes AFTER the hour (e.g., 3:15). 'Quarter to' means 15 minutes BEFORE the next hour (e.g., 2:45, which is a quarter to 3).

MISTAKE: Directly adding or subtracting fractions of time without converting to a common unit (like minutes). | CORRECTION: Always convert fractions of hours or days into minutes or hours first, then perform addition or subtraction.

Practice Questions
Try It Yourself

QUESTION: Your bus ride takes 3/4 of an hour. How many minutes is that? | ANSWER: 45 minutes

QUESTION: A movie is 2 and 1/2 hours long. If it starts at 6:00 PM, what time will it finish? | ANSWER: 8:30 PM

QUESTION: Rohan studied for 1/3 of an hour in the morning and 1/4 of an hour in the evening. For how many minutes did he study in total? | ANSWER: 35 minutes

Key Vocabulary
Key Terms

FRACTION: A part of a whole | HOUR: A unit of time equal to 60 minutes | MINUTE: A unit of time equal to 60 seconds | QUARTER: One-fourth (1/4) of something
